67-4-2807. Assessment of tax, penalties and interest Notice Collection.

Notwithstanding any other law, an assessment against a dealer who possesses an unauthorized substance to which a stamp has not been affixed as required by this part shall be made as provided in this section. The commissioner shall assess tax, applicable penalty, and interest based on any information brought to the attention of the commissioner, or the commissioner's duly authorized assistants, that a person is liable for unpaid tax pursuant to this part. The tax shall be assessed in the same manner as any other tax assessment, except when this part specifies otherwise. The commissioner shall notify the dealer in writing of the amount of the tax, penalty, and interest due. The notice of assessment shall be either mailed to the dealer at the dealer's last known address or served on the dealer in person. If the dealer does not pay the tax, penalty, and interest upon receipt of the notice of assessment, the commissioner shall collect the assessment, including penalty and interest, pursuant to the procedures set forth in chapter 1, part 14, of this title. The dealer may seek review of the assessment as provided in chapter 1, part 18, of this title. Section 67-1-1802 is applicable to the tax levied by this part, except that a claim for refund shall be filed within six (6) months of the date of payment of the tax.

[Acts 2004, ch. 803, § 8; 2007, ch. 602, § 28.]
